This was a movie whose trailor was played all day, everyday, as the build-up to the release loomed here in Cape Town. Me, im one for swash-buckling pirates and handsome hero's, so of course i was intruiged and dutifully paid the fee to see the movie, although i have to add that my expectations were sky high, and this is normally a recipe for intense disappointment.

But not this day, this movie. It had me from the opening sequence, to the end credits and left me wanting more. i found the entire movie a marvel, the characters well scripted and perfectly brought to life. above all of that though, the humour and wit brought forth by the wondeful Jack Sparrow and counterparts made the film. the chemistry was perfect and this is definitely a movie i would indeed pay to see once again.

as mentioned, Johnny Depp was PERFECTLY cast as Jack Sparrow, Captain Jack Sparrow that is. He melded with this character and there is truthfully none other i could see in the role. it was tailor made and he fit it like a glove. it was also interestingly refreshing to see him in a role that departed from the "Sleepy Hollow" "From Hell" spectrums of the last few years.

Orlando Bloom, an actor surrounded with much hype. and i have to say much deserved. He was fantastic, and a wonderful support. Will Turners chemistry with Captain Jack is a marvel to watch and i found myself smiling an aweful lot. and yes, i too drowned in his gorgeously long lashed eyes!

Kiera Knightly, the herione is one that i did not care for much. despite her success in Bend it like Beckham, Kiera never really captivated me, but even she had me smiling and praising the casting directors for their choice. she was lovely and a wonderful foil for the otherwise all male cast.

there is no other rating but 5/5; 10/10 Excellent, and more inportantly a movie that EVERYONE, adult and child alike would love. something for everyone!!!
